The Yahoo Transport has been updated, and now appears to work correctly. I don't have many yahoo contacts in my roster so I can't tell easily.
UPDATE: It works correctly, but has been having problems with a corrupted database. I've dumped and reimported the database, so this should be fine now, but you may need to re-register with the transport service